Output 8395aabaee7a06a85f11d061964341ce993d0fcf40337e05c92e88a2a6c399db:0

value
18407769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b56c57e40ae100ed96982a6f5399f04e616fa3 OP_EQUAL
address
3JtpJ7ZUGSwFh4hhWPgf64C3ifFC5yHtAj
transaction
8395aabaee7a06a85f11d061964341ce993d0fcf40337e05c92e88a2a6c399db
spent
true